期刊文献+

基于Linux的软件DSM实现 被引量:1

Implementation of Software Distributed Shared Memory in Linux
下载PDF
导出
摘要 分布式共享存储系统在分布式存储器的基础上构造逻辑上的共享存储模型。提出了在操作系统层实现分布式共享存储的系统框架,并以Linux操作系统为平台介绍了其实现。该系统提供简单的调用接口,并与Linux内存管理框架紧密结合。通过采用合适的DSM一致性协议提高了整体性能。 The purpose of distributed shared memory is to build up shared memory model logically on distributed memory. This paper proposes a framework that implementing distributed shared memory in the operating system based on Linux. It provides a simple programming interface that does not require any network programming, and extends the Linux VM system in a non-intrusive way. By using proper consistency protocol, the system performance gets improved.
作者 李鹏 王雷
出处 《计算机工程》 EI CAS CSCD 北大核心 2006年第4期58-60,共3页 Computer Engineering
关键词 分布式共享存储系统 操作系统 内存管理 一致性协议 Distributed shared memory (DSM) Operating system Memory management Consistency protocol
  • 相关文献

参考文献7

  • 1Roy S,Chaudhary V.Strings:A High-Performance Distributed Shared Memory for Symmetrical Multiprocessor Clusters[C].Proceedings of the Seventh IEEE 18th International Symposium on High Performance Distributed Computing,1998:28.
  • 2Swanson M,Staller L,Carter J.Making Distributed Shared Memory Simple,Yet Efficient[C].Proceedings of the 3rd International Workshop on High Level Parallel Programming Models and Supportive Environments,1998-03:2.
  • 3Souto P,Stark E W.A Distributed Shared Memory Facility for FreeBSD[C].Proceedings of the USENIX Annual Technical Conference,1997-01:149.
  • 4毛德操 胡希明.Linux内核源代码情景分析[M].杭州:浙江大学出版社,2001..
  • 5戴华东,夏军,杨学军.分布式共享存储系统中的存储管理及优化技术[J].计算机工程,2003,29(5):13-15. 被引量:3
  • 6Tanenbaum A S.陆丽娜,伍卫国,刘隆国等译.分布式系统[M].北京:清华大学出版社,2002.
  • 7Li K,Hudak P.Memory Coherence in Shared Virtual Memory Systems[J].ACM Transactions on Computer Systems,1989,7(4):321.

二级参考文献4

  • 1[1]Yang Xuejun, Dai Huadong. Operation System-centric Memory Consistency Model--Thread Consistency Model[R]. The Fourth International Workshop on Advanced Parallel Processing Technologies (APPT'01), 2001-09:26-36
  • 2[2]Verghese B, Devien S, Gupta A, et al. Operating System Support for Improving Data Locality on Cc-numa Compute Servers[A]. In Proceedings of the Seventh International Conference on Architectual Support for Programming Languages and Operating Systems(ASPLOS Ⅶ)[C], 1996-10:279-289
  • 3[3]Laudon J, Lenoski D. The SGI Origin:A ccNUMA Highly Scalable Server[A]. In Proceedings of the 24th Annual International Symposium on Computer Architecture [C],1997-05
  • 4[4]Nikolopoulos D, Papatheodorou T, Polychronopoulos C, et al. User Level Dynamic Page Migration for Multiprogrammed Shared-memory Multiprocessors[A]. In Proceedings of the 29th International Conference on Parallel Processing[C], 2000-08

共引文献196

同被引文献3

引证文献1

二级引证文献3

相关作者

内容加载中请稍等...

相关机构

内容加载中请稍等...

相关主题

内容加载中请稍等...

浏览历史

内容加载中请稍等...
;
使用帮助 返回顶部